カンフー・ファン必見!愛と宿命のバトルを繰り広げる『グランド・マスター』

すべての始まりは、ウォン監督が『ブエノスアイレス』撮影中のアルゼンチンで、ブルース・リーが表紙の雑誌を見たこと。遠い外国で愛され続けている彼の映画を撮りたいと熱望したのだ。それから17年の間に、構想は中国武術の世界へと広がり、8年もの歳月をかけて、膨大な資料の研究と、現在のグランド・マスターたちへの綿密な取材を実施した。動乱の時代に翻弄された20世紀前半を中心に、中国武術の壮大な歴史に真正面から立ち向かい、撮影に3年を費やした渾身の最新作となった。
また、役者陣には今やアジアから世界のトップスターに登りつめた、トニー・レオン、チャン・ツィイーの二大俳優に加え、鋭利な存在感で異彩を放ったチャン・チェンら豪華なメンバーが集結。全カンフー・ファンが待ち焦がれていた超大作がいよいよ日本公開を迎え、期待は高まるばかりだ。
世界をのみこむ戦争の足音が刻一刻と迫る1930~40年代、中国。流派を極めた長は宗師〈グランド・マスター〉と呼ばれるが、北の八卦掌の宗師である宮宝(ゴン・バオ)は引退を決意し、その地位と生涯をかけた南北統一の使命を最強の者に譲ろうとする。
候補は形意拳の使い手である一番弟子の馬三(マーサン)と、南の詠春拳の宗師・葉問(イップ・マン)。パオセンの娘で、奥義六十四手を唯一受け継ぐ宮若梅(ゴン・ルオメイ)も、父の反対を押して名乗りを上げる。
だが、野望に目の眩んだマーサンがパオセンを殺害、ルオメイはイップ・マンへの想いを胸の奥底に沈め、女としての幸せを捨て、仇討ちを誓う。継承者争いと復讐劇、愛と憎しみが絡み合う、壮絶な幕が切って落とされた。八極拳の宗師で一線天(カミソリ)と呼ばれる謎の男も、不穏な動きを見せている。果たして、力と技と心で闘いを制し、真のグランド・マスターとなるのは誰か──?

A group of 20-30 men and women with 12 horses and sleighs will travel during three days, crossing snowed roads and iced lakes, to reach to reach the opening day of R¯ros winter fair in Norway. A Royal decree of 1853 states that from 1854 onwards a yearly market shall be held in R¯ros, commencing the second last Tuesday in the month of February, lasting until the following Friday.ù Every year more than 200 people will travel to R¯ross as their ancestors did hundreds of years ago.
